You're seeing traffic but few case inquiries

Why This Happens

Your website doesn't clearly communicate your expertise, case results, or how to hire you. Visitors land, browse, and leave—no conversion path.

The Real Cost

At $5,800/month digital spend, a 1% conversion rate costs you $5–8 cases per month. Competitors with optimized sites convert at 4–6%, winning the cases you miss.

🔍

Local competitors outrank you for '[Practice Area] lawyer Boston'

Why This Happens

Your website lacks local SEO structure (NAP consistency, local schema, location pages, review velocity). Google can't confidently rank you locally.

The Real Cost

You're invisible to 60% of high-intent local searchers. Each month they find competitors instead, costing $12K–20K in lost revenue per practice area.

📉

Google Ads cost per lead is $180–$300; margins shrinking

Why This Happens

Your landing pages and site experience aren't optimized for ad traffic. Poor relevance score, high bounce rate, and weak conversion funnels inflate your CPC.

The Real Cost

You're paying premium prices to reach people, then failing to convert them. A 3% improvement in conversion rate cuts your cost per case by 40%+.

Our Process

How We Get You Results

No mystery. No black box. Here's exactly what happens when you work with us — and what you'll receive at each stage.

1

Competitive & Local Audit

Week 1–2

We map your competitive landscape across Boston (Back Bay, Seaport, and beyond). We analyze the top 5 firms ranking for your practice areas, their site structure, local SEO signals, and conversion tactics. You'll see exactly why they rank and what your site is missing.

Deliverable

Detailed audit report: competitive benchmarks, local search gaps, conversion friction points, and a ranked priority roadmap.

2

Strategy & Information Architecture

Week 2–3

We design your site's structure around how prospects actually search and decide. For a Boston family law firm, this means dedicated pages for each practice area, case results, attorney bios, and trust signals. We map the conversion funnel: awareness → consideration → inquiry.

Deliverable

Sitemap, wireframes, content outline, and keyword strategy targeting Boston local + practice-area searches.

3

Design & Conversion Optimization

Week 4–6

We build a mobile-first website that ranks *and* converts. Clear value props, compelling case results, prominent inquiry forms, live chat, and testimonials. Every page is designed to move prospects closer to calling or filling out a consultation request.

Deliverable

Fully designed and built website (mobile-responsive), conversion tracking setup, and initial SEO implementation.

4

Local SEO & Technical Foundation

Week 6–8

We implement local schema markup, optimize Google Business Profile, build local citations, and ensure fast load speeds. This sends strong signals to Google that you're a trusted local firm. Boston prospects searching on mobile will find you.

Deliverable

Local SEO foundation complete: schema, GBP optimization, site speed <2s, internal linking, and initial rankings tracking.

5

Launch, Testing & Optimization

Ongoing (Week 8+)

We launch your site, monitor performance (traffic, rankings, conversions), and run A/B tests on key pages. We adjust CTAs, forms, messaging, and calls-to-action based on real visitor behavior. Optimization is continuous—your site gets smarter every month.

Deliverable

Live site, analytics dashboard, monthly performance reports, and quarterly optimization recommendations.

How long does it take to see results from a new law firm website?+
You'll see traffic increases within 4–6 weeks as the site goes live and initial SEO takes hold. Meaningful rankings and consistent inquiry growth typically appear by week 8–12. Local search results move faster than organic—many clients rank on Google Maps within 6–8 weeks. We provide a detailed timeline during strategy.
Will my website work for multiple practice areas (e.g., family law, criminal defense, mediation)?+
Yes. We build a site architecture with dedicated pages for each practice area, attorney bios, and messaging tailored to how prospects search. This actually boosts SEO—Google loves thematic clarity. Each practice area gets its own conversion funnel and trust-building section.

I'm using a template (Wix, Squarespace) for my firm. Should I switch?+
Templates look professional but lack the conversion optimization and SEO architecture that Google prefers for law firms. They also limit customization for trust-building (results pages, attorney profiles, testimonials). Most template sites convert at 0.5–1%; custom sites we build convert at 3–5%+. If your template is dragging, it's worth switching. We can usually migrate your content cleanly.
What if I already have a website? Can you improve it without a full redesign?+
Yes. We offer optimization audits ($2,500–$4,500) that identify quick wins: conversion improvements, SEO fixes, mobile optimization, and messaging clarity. Many clients see 30–50% improvement from optimization alone. If the foundation is weak, a redesign may be more cost-effective long-term. We'll recommend the right path after an audit.
How do you handle competitor websites that already rank well locally?+
We analyze what they're doing right (content, trust signals, local authority) and build a strategy that beats them on relevance, specificity, and conversion. We target long-tail searches where you can rank faster, then expand to broad terms. Boston's market is large enough for multiple firms to rank—we make sure you're one of them.
